In Kenya, the Mombasa-Nairobi Standard Gauge Railway (SGR) is said to be a project that has changed everything. It runs faster than other road traffic and old railway lines and is also popular among travelers. It’s making the port of Mombasa cheaper, more convenient and a better choice for trade in East Africa. But according to Nairobi-based journalist Juliet Njau, people have realized that impacts from the SGR are more than just economical. So, in this episode of our special series “Road to a Bright Future”, we speak with Juliet Njau on how the SGR has been helping female workers in the country.
